comparison src/share/vm/ci/ciEnv.cpp @ 10197:7b23cb975cf2

8011675: adding compilation level to replay data Reviewed-by: kvn, vlivanov
author iignatyev
date Thu, 25 Apr 2013 11:09:24 -0700
parents e12c9b3740db
children 9ce110b1d14a
comparison
equal deleted inserted replaced
10196:dc7db03f5aa2 10197:7b23cb975cf2
1162 GrowableArray<ciMetadata*>* objects = _factory->get_ci_metadata(); 1162 GrowableArray<ciMetadata*>* objects = _factory->get_ci_metadata();
1163 out->print_cr("# %d ciObject found", objects->length()); 1163 out->print_cr("# %d ciObject found", objects->length());
1164 for (int i = 0; i < objects->length(); i++) { 1164 for (int i = 0; i < objects->length(); i++) {
1165 objects->at(i)->dump_replay_data(out); 1165 objects->at(i)->dump_replay_data(out);
1166 } 1166 }
1167 Method* method = task()->method(); 1167 CompileTask* task = this->task();
1168 int entry_bci = task()->osr_bci(); 1168 Method* method = task->method();
1169 int entry_bci = task->osr_bci();
1170 int comp_level = task->comp_level();
1169 // Klass holder = method->method_holder(); 1171 // Klass holder = method->method_holder();
1170 out->print_cr("compile %s %s %s %d", 1172 out->print_cr("compile %s %s %s %d %d",
1171 method->klass_name()->as_quoted_ascii(), 1173 method->klass_name()->as_quoted_ascii(),
1172 method->name()->as_quoted_ascii(), 1174 method->name()->as_quoted_ascii(),
1173 method->signature()->as_quoted_ascii(), 1175 method->signature()->as_quoted_ascii(),
1174 entry_bci); 1176 entry_bci, comp_level);
1175 out->flush(); 1177 out->flush();
1176 } 1178 }